Beautiful boutique hotel with stunning views
This hotel is ideally located by the shores of the gorgeous Cala Carbó cove and has views of Ibiza's most stunning rock island, Es Vedra. It is the ideal spot for those wanting a tranquil holiday.
The hotel has a variety of apartments and studios, all of which have wonderful sea views. Each room comes with a TV, WiFi and air-conditioning.
Guests are able to take a dip in the pool, enjoy early evening drinks at the rooftop bar or have a delicious meal from one of the restaurants at the hotel.
The hotel is just 10 minutes from the picturesque San Josep village and half an hour from Ibiza Airport.

The 19th century Esglesia de Sant Agusti is a large stone building whitewashed in typical Balearic style and topped with a bell tower, it is distinctive when compared to other Ibizan churches by its lack of porch area common to most.
Sa Caleta was the first settlement of the Phoenicians in the 8th century BC. Evidence shows they settled here for around 50 years before relocating to Eivissa and abandoning Sa Caleta forever.

Just off the western coast of the island lies an small archipelago of uninhabited islands. The largest of these is Illa de sa Conillera, literally translated at "rabbit island", due to its residents.
San Antonio is the town by which many people define Ibiza. During the 1980's the town hit a development boom, as tourists (mainly English), flocked in their thousands to visit the sunny resort and dance the night away.
